of being completely retarded, emo, and sucking of the balls.
"That fag over there is so lazory."
by notallyn February 22, 2004
3 2
1)noun, sex with a Canadian girl.
2)verb, having sex with a Canadian girl.
1) "I just got some MUNGAI!!!"
2) "I'll be giving you sweet mungai tonight."
by notallyn February 23, 2004
7 8